Output 364bb9230efd0412e8052c343daafb19be5ae61962188699797ad089ef39ce89:1

value
1566843
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c9db8a7a5778980f68a6b2c54885abb35916e94 OP_EQUALVERIFY OP_CHECKSIG
address
16XWVBMEdhy7C1kydFRLaHPyPYgBW7cgWT
transaction
364bb9230efd0412e8052c343daafb19be5ae61962188699797ad089ef39ce89
confirmations
521053
spent
true